‘Star Power’ Takes Center Stage On ‘Little Big Shots’

CLARK COUNTY, Ky (LEX 18) Clark County will take the center stage Thursday night as the kids from Studio One School of Dance in Winchester shows off their stuff on NBC’s ‘Little Big Shots’.

After months of waiting and anticipation, the kids of Star Power from Studio One School of Dance will show off their clogging prowess. 

Marlee McFadden, Cadence Johnson, and Gracie Abney, along with their teammate Sarah James, and Malachki Long have been dancing together for four years and will be one of several groups showing their stuff on ‘Little Big Shots’. 

"I had always dreamed since I was like two to be on tv so I was like, wow this is great!" Cadence said.

Coach Kelly Fithen said that their road to the show was all a surprise. She said that a producer found them after seeing a video of their performance on YouTube. 

"Oh my gosh, I was so excited it caught me off guard for sure. But we just could not be more excited that they called," said Fithen. 

The episode was filmed back in October and all five dancers flew to Los Angeles for an unforgettable week.

"In L.A. it was a great experience meeting everybody," Gracie said. 

They are excited to show clogging to the whole world.

Thursday night, July 12, 2018, Star Power will be on Little Big Shots.
